Abstract
Ultramafic-mafic rocks from Makrirrakhi, Central Greece exhibit features of an original ophiolite sequence which contains depleted mantle material, ultramafic containing partial melt textures and possibly the mafic “pluton” which resulted from the coalescing of these partial melt segregations. Considerable mineralogical variation exists: unzoned olivine crystals range in composition from Fo78–84 (mafics) to Fo88–92 (ultramafics), plagioclases An64–79 (mafics) to An80–90 (ultramafics) and spinel varies from a chromian spinel (ultramafics) to a more aluminous-titaniferous spinel (mafics). Pyroxenes from the ultramafics display a limited range: En89–92 Fs9–8 Wo0–2 (orthopyroxene) and En48–54 Fs1–10 Wo38–50 (clinopyroxene). Mafic rocks display a greater range being richer in ferrosilite En36–65 Fs3–20 Wo33–51. Pyroxenes from within the partial melt segregations have chemical affinities with those from the gabbrotroctolite series. A model of partial melt within the upper mantle, and, a set of criteria to distinguish partial melt textures from cumulate textures, are developed from analytical data and textural evidence.
